摘要 <P>PROBLEM TO BE SOLVED: To provide a lighting device capable of suppressing occurrence of ion migration and enhancing the circuit efficiency of a power supply unit. <P>SOLUTION: The lighting device 1 comprises a unit substrate 2, series circuits C1-C5, and a power supply unit applying series voltage to series circuits. The substrate 2 comprises a plurality of pads 5. Series circuits are arranged in a meandering manner on the substrate 2. The series circuits consist of a plurality of LED 11 mounted on the substrate 2 and arranged alternately with a plurality of pads 5, a bonding wire 12 electrically connecting LED 11 with pads 5, and pads 5. At least of a pad 5 and a plurality of LED 11 are arranged in a circuit region A, between bending parts of meandering of series circuits, and pads 5 are arranged in a circuit region B consisting a bending part of the meandering. Thus, the difference among the electrical potentials in the circuit regions A, adjacent to the advancing direction of meandering and the difference in the electrical potentials of the pads 5 included in the circuit region Bs adjacent to the advancing direction of meandering are set smaller than series voltage applied to series circuits. <P>COPYRIGHT: (C)2009,JPO&INPIT
